clerestory
noun clere·sto·ry \ˈklir-ˌstȯr-ē, -st(ə-)rē\
: the upper part of a wall that rises above a roof and that has windows

Origin of CLERESTORY
Middle English, from clere clear + story
First Known Use: 15th century
